  • rikipedia wrote: 89 points

    October 31, 2019 - Light mahogany red. Resonant perfume of redcurrant, strawberry, scrub/heather - almost garrigue - with baked clay and stalky/stem notes. A lively attack with mineral, dried cranberry, more redcurrant, fresh herbs, rhubarb and a savoury sous-bois underlay. The acid is bright and vigorous with sandy texture and a more grippy tannins midway between a Pinot Noir and light Nebbiolo. Later there is a little raspberry compote and strawberry jelly powder and some slight evolved note suggesting it is not going any further. But a delicious vibrant, very pure mineral-tinged wine
